Table 2 Cognitive scores at 18–21 months and 6–8 years.

From: Cognitive development at late infancy and school age in children cooled for neonatal encephalopathy

Cognitive outcomes

Participants (n = 49)

Bayley-III

 Age at assessment (months), mean (SD)

18.5 (0.6)

 Cognitive composite, mean (SD)

103.7 (11.6)

 Language composite, mean (SD)

103.2 (13.7)

 Cognitive and language composite, mean (SD)

103.4 (11.3)

WISC-IV

 Age at assessment (years), mean (SD)

7.0 (0.5)

 Full-scale IQ, mean (SD)

95.4 (11.7)

 Full-scale IQ < 85, no. (%)

8 (16.3)

 Verbal comprehension index, mean (SD)

97.6 (11.3)

 Perceptual reasoning index, mean (SD)

92.9 (12.3)

 Working memory index, mean (SD)

95.4 (13.1)

 Processing speed indexa, mean (SD)

99.9 (14.6)

  1. Data presented are for the participants included in the main analysis.
  2. aThe variable had one missing value.
